About the team

The payments landscape is changing rapidly and our team is at the forefront of this transformation. Depending on where you live you may be used to paying with a credit card (United States) iDEAL (Netherlands) or UPI (India) among hundreds of other global payment methods. How you pay is increasingly dependent on where you are what kind of consumer you are and what business youre buying from.

The Global and Local Payment Methods (LPM) team is responsible for Stripes products outside of the US as well as Stripes fastestgrowing payments business: local payment methods. We help Stripe expand globally and build the payment methods that help businesses drastically increase their revenues and grow. Underpinning all of this we also build the platform that enables us to scale and distribute payment methods efficiently.

What youll do

As the Product Lead Head of Americas and Bank Methods at Stripe you will be responsible for two strategically important pillars of the Global and LPM team:

  • Our product strategy roadmap and execution in Latin America and Canada (all nonUS countries in the Americas) and
  • Our Bank Methods products.

For Latin America and Canada youll help determine which product features we should prioritize to win in these markets. In LatAm you will improve productmarket fit in Mexico and chart a product strategy for Brazil. You will also help evaluate whether and how we should expand into other LatAm countries. Youll think creatively about the product and infrastructure required to achieve our goals and assess whether to build partner or buy in the region. This work will require deep crossfunctional collaboration with other product teams to ensure their products are localized effectively.

As the leader for the Bank Methods team youll define the strategy set the roadmap and work closely with engineering to build Stripes Bank Methods products. Your work will span:

  • Strategic direction (e.g. should we focus on B2B businesses platforms Enterprise or selfserve)
  • Product design (e.g. how do we build a product with the low cost of bank methods and the ease of use of credit cards) and
  • Daytoday roadmap execution.

For both pillars your scope will be global though the engineering teams you work with will primarily be based in the US and Europe.
